Well I've had it for a few weeks now and been playing with it a lot. Getting used to it can certainly be a frustrating business, but luckily I have a lot of patience. I did a factory reset with the online firmware (very easy to do) then loaded firmware 3.1.12.510.

I put it on my CZ 455 initially and got it zeroed at 50yds, 13yards (garden ratty distance) and 25yards. I'm still not having much luck with the ballistic calculator but that might just be the short ranges involved. It's very easy to just swap profiles when you have set distances to shoot.

I had it all nicely set up and then pressed 'load from SD card' when I changed profile and promptly over-wrote all my settings. Lesson-- SAVE the profiles to SD BEFORE you try to reload them!

I found it to be constantly crashing to such an extent that I took it off the CZ and put it on my AA S410 so I wouldn't be losing my rabbit gun and the daytime sight picture really doesn't compare to a decent glass scope.

With experimenting I've found that when freshly charged to full it will crash every few minutes for around five to ten minutes before it settles down and behaves itself until the next charge, Odd to say the least.

Last night I staked out the garden trying for the elusive last member (probably) of a ratty family who moved in last week. This one was only coming out at night and being very careful having seen the rest of his family being taken out one by one. At half nine last night he availed himself of the birdseed on the lawn in the pitch darkness and promptly joined his family in ratty heaven. The night capabilities of this sight are VERY impressive.

I am becoming more impressed with this sight every time I use it and will put it back onto a 22rf for the winter for rabbiting.
